The differentiating factor as pointed out by tRon is sport - and according to TTV research 60% of people don't care about sport (...accurate or not, I know many people like myself who don't!)
They both cover all the other genres using different providers, but the content seems to be very similar.
IMO, TTV has a better offering than DSTV's Premium package in the foll areas: music video channels (very comprehensive range catering for all tastes, even classical, rock, etc), news (missing only ETV News Channel), cultural channels (BET, RTPi, Zee), and even Christian religious channels.
DSTV has the upperhand in Sport, Movies, and offer something for the other religious groups too.
So yes, TTV is definitely an alternative to DSTV, but needs to strengthen their movie offerings especially (I assume the non-sport lovers are avid movie watchers). We understand this as being due to launch limitations, and expect it to be rectified within the next few months .....or else....!
